On this
date, Wildlife, Fisheries and Environmental Officers from across North America
will be collecting pledges in support of The Game Warden Museum and riding their
motorcycles to the Game Warden Museum site located at the International Peace
Gardens located on the Manitoba and North Dakota border.
All
proceeds from this event will be donated to the Game Warden Museum in order to
support final phase construction at the site.
